Cited Structures: list of articles citing SSGCID structures

We are actively tracking the number of publications by the scientific community which reference our structures, whether in the main text, figure captions or supplementary material. Selected articles are manually reviewed. Publications by SSGCID authors are excluded from the manually reviewed list. From our manual curation results, we estimate that the false positive rate might be as high as 50% for some structures.

This list was obtained from Google Scholar searches using an API provided by Christian Kreibich.
